Tile damage repair services involve addressing issues such as cracked, chipped, loose, or broken tiles to restore the appearance and functionality of tiled surfaces. These services typically include removing damaged tiles, preparing the underlying surface, and installing new tiles that match the existing pattern and material. Skilled contractors may also perform grout and sealant repairs to ensure a seamless finish and prevent future damage. The goal is to improve the durability and visual appeal of tiled areas, whether in residential or commercial settings.

This type of repair service helps resolve common problems caused by wear and tear, impacts, or moisture infiltration. Cracked or loose tiles can pose safety hazards and may lead to further structural issues if not addressed promptly. Water damage in bathrooms, kitchens, or outdoor patios can weaken tile adhesive and cause tiles to lift or fall out. Repairing damaged tiles prevents water infiltration, reduces the risk of accidents, and prolongs the lifespan of tiled surfaces.

The overview below groups typical Tile Damage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Washington County, WI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Tile Damage Repair Costs - Repair costs for damaged tiles typically range from $150 to $600 per area, depending on the extent of the damage and tile type. For example, replacing a few cracked tiles may cost around $200, while extensive damage could reach $600 or more.

Labor Expenses - Labor charges for tile repair services often fall between $50 and $100 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the repair complexity and the size of the affected area.

Material Costs - The price of replacement tiles varies widely, generally from $3 to $20 per square foot. Custom or high-end tiles can significantly increase the overall repair expenses.

Additional Fees - Extra costs may include surface preparation, grout removal, and cleaning, which can add $50 to $200 to the total. These fees depend on the specific repair requirements and local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es tile damage that requires repair? Tile damage can result from impacts, water exposure, thermal stress, or improper installation, leading to cracks, chips, or looseness.

How can damaged tiles be repaired or replaced? Local tile repair specialists can assess the damage and recommend options such as patching, regrouting, or replacing affected tiles.

Is tile damage repair a DIY project? Repairing tile damage often requires specialized tools and skills, so it is typically recommended to contact professional tile repair services.

How long does tile damage repair usually take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but most repairs can be completed within a few hours to a day.

What types of tiles can be repaired? Most common tile types, including ceramic, porcelain, and natural stone, can be repaired or replaced by local specialists.
